Role: Medical staff responsible for donor evaluation and safety at plasma collection centers. Objectives include assessing donor suitability via medical history, physical assessments, and test result reviews, providing emergency care, and counseling donors on reactive test outcomes. Responsibilities encompass interviewing donors, reviewing tests, managing routine care per SOPs, escalating critical cases to medical physicians, and collaborating with the Center Medical Director. Requirements: graduation from paramedic, nursing, physician assistant, chiropractic, medical school, or naturopathic training; current licensure or certification as a physician, RN, or emergency technician if applicable; minimum one year of healthcare experience; experience in blood or plasma collection preferred.
